Exploring Beam Clamps, 3/8 Beam Clamps, and Girder Clamps in Construction and Engineering



Beam clamps, including 3/8 beam clamps and girder clamps, are essential components in construction and engineering, providing secure and reliable solutions for attaching fixtures, equipment, and structural elements to beams and girders. Understanding the characteristics, applications, and considerations for these types of clamps is crucial for selecting the right components for specific projects.

 

Beam Clamps:

 

Beam clamps are designed to attach to structural beams, providing a secure anchoring point for suspending equipment, piping, conduit, and other fixtures. These clamps are commonly used in construction, industrial, and commercial applications to support the weight of various systems and components. Beam clamps are available in different configurations, including fixed, swivel, and adjustable designs, offering flexibility in positioning and load distribution.

 

3/8 Beam Clamps:

 

3/8 beam clamps are a specific size of beam clamps commonly used in construction and engineering applications. These clamps are designed to accommodate beams with specific dimensions and load requirements. The 3/8 size designation refers to the diameter of the threaded rod or bolt used to secure the clamp to the beam. 3/8 beam clamps are often used in applications where a balance between strength and size is required, providing a reliable and efficient solution for attaching fixtures and equipment to beams.

 

Girder Clamps:

 

Girder clamps, also known as I-beam clamps, are designed to attach to the flange of steel girders or I-beams, providing a secure and stable anchoring point for suspending loads and equipment. These clamps are commonly used in industrial and construction settings to support overhead cranes, hoists, conveyors, and other heavy equipment. Girder clamps are available in various configurations, including fixed, adjustable, and trolley-mounted designs, offering versatility and load-bearing capabilities for different applications.

 

Considerations for Selection:

 

When selecting beam clamps, 3/8 beam clamps, or girder clamps, it is important to consider factors such as load capacity, beam dimensions, material compatibility, and environmental conditions to ensure that the clamps meet the specific application requirements. Additionally, compliance with industry standards and safety regulations is crucial for ensuring the reliability and performance of these clamping solutions in diverse construction and engineering applications.
